网站托管性能:当数据开始呼吸,服务器便有了心跳
我们常以为网页加载是一场无声的仪式——指尖轻点,画面浮现。可那毫秒级的迟滞、偶发的空白屏、深夜三点突然崩溃的后台管理界面……它们并非故障本身;而是系统在喘息,在低语,在用错误码写下一封封未署名的情书。
一、速度不是目标,是生存状态
“快”从来不是一个孤立参数。它不等于CPU频率飙升时风扇发出的嘶鸣,也不单指CDN节点离用户更近几公里。真正的网站托管性能,是你点击提交按钮后第三百二十七毫秒,数据库完成事务并返回确认信号的那个瞬间——微弱却确凿的存在感。这其间穿行着DNS解析、TLS握手、HTTP/3多路复用、缓存穿透检测与边缘函数执行链……每一个环节都像钟表内部一组咬合精密的游丝齿轮。差之分毫不显其害,积久成疾则整座数字楼宇悄然倾斜。于是有人把TTFB(首字节时间)当作KPI来供奉,殊不知真正致命的是第十九次重试后的连接超时——那一刻,人已离开页面,而日志仍在徒劳地记录一个永不抵达的请求。
二、“稳定”的背面,站着无数被抹去的名字
人们谈论高可用性时常说:“九个九”。但没人细数过那些没出现在SLA协议里的时刻:凌晨四点半负载突增导致自动扩缩失败;某云服务商区域网络抖动引发跨AZ流量绕转失序;甚至只是Linux内核一次静默升级所遗留的一处TCP TIME_WAIT泄露。这些幽灵事件从不在监控图表中标红闪烁,只以缓慢爬升的延迟曲线或渐进式内存泄漏的方式现身。就像一场慢性病,症状轻微到可以忽略,直到某个促销活动启动前两小时,整个支付网关忽然陷入集体沉默。此时才发觉,“稳定性”,原来是由千万个未曾命名的小决策堆叠而成的地基——每一次对冗余架构的选择,每一回拒绝降配省钱的坚持,每一条没有跳过的安全补丁更新通知……
三、人的耐受力才是终极基准线
技术指标终将退潮,留下沙滩上的人类痕迹。“我等了七秒钟。”一位电商客户曾这样写道,邮件末尾附了一张手机截图:购物车图标旁悬浮着旋转圆圈。他并未抱怨服务宕机,也没有质疑功能缺失。他的愤怒精准指向一种感受性的剥夺——那个本该由浏览器承担的时间债务,最终摊派到了他自己身上。因此衡量托管性能最锋利的标准,或许不该来自New Relic面板上的P95响应耗时,而是真实访客放弃等待的比例变化率,或是客服对话中出现“打不开”三个字的日均频次。人在屏幕另一端眨眼的速度约莫三百五十毫秒;超过这个阈值,注意力即如沙漏倾泻不可逆流。所以一切优化的本质,都是为人类意识预留出从容落脚的空间。
四、未来不会更快,只会更深地嵌入生活肌理
AI驱动的内容交付正让静态资源变得愈发动态化;WebAssembly使复杂计算得以直接运行于前端而不必反复往返云端;Serverless形态模糊了传统运维边界的同时,也将责任进一步下压至开发者手中。这意味着未来的网站托管性能不再仅关乎带宽吞吐量或磁盘IOPS数值,更是关于上下文感知能力、实时行为预测精度以及异常模式自愈效率的整体呈现。换而言之:机器正在学习如何理解你的意图尚未形成之时的样子。而这其中最难解的问题或许是——当我们赋予基础设施越来越多拟人性的能力之后,是否也悄悄交出了某种判断权?比如,决定哪位用户的视频优先缓冲完毕,或者何时切断疑似恶意刷量者的长链接?
最后要说一句未必实用的话:别迷信工具箱里最新的那一颗螺丝钉。最好的托管方案往往藏匿于删减而非添加之中。少一份不必要的插件依赖,就减少一层潜在延迟能源;精简一行无意义的数据序列化逻辑,则可能挽救千名并发访问者共有的半秒耐心。毕竟所谓卓越性能,并非奔向极限的过程,而是不断校准自身节奏,直至成为观者眼中那种无需解释的流畅存在——如同晨光漫过窗棂,无人追问它是怎样穿越大气层而来。